In November 2013, the United States initiated an anti-subsidy investigation on imports of non-oriented electrical steel from China, Rep. of Korea and Chinese Taipei. The investigation is still in progress. In March 2014, a provisional duty was imposed. The investigation is still in progress. In October 2014, the definitive duty was terminated from Rep. of Korea. In December 2014, a definitive duty was imposed on China, and Chinese Taipei. In November 2019, a sunset review was initiated on China, and Chinese Taipei and the definitive duty was extended for a new period in December 2020. In November 2025, a sunset review was initiated (notice published in December 2025) and the definitive duty was extended for a new period in May 2026.
